Charlotte, The Vermont Whale
In 1849 workers unearthed the bones of a mysterious animal near the town of Charlotte. Buried nearly 10 feet below the surface in a thick blue, the bones were identified as those of a beluga or white whale, an animal that inhabits arctic and subarctic marine waters in the northern hemisphere.

Falls of the Ohio State Park
Falls of the Ohio State Park Lewis & Clark Bicentennial Located on the banks of the Ohio River in Clarksville, Indiana at I-65 exit 0 is the Falls of the Ohio State Park. The 386-million-year-old fossil beds are among the largest naturally exposed Devonian fossil beds in the world. Mazon Creek Fossils
The plants and animals found in concretions recovered from the Francis Creek Shale are some of the most exciting and important fossils that have been found in the state of Illinois.
